COMSOL Multiphysics (formerly FEMLAB) is a finite element analysis software package that includes predefined partial differential equations for many fields of physics.

Notes for COMSOL users

  • COMSOL has a library of the properties of common materials, but if you want to use it, you must start COMSOL in SI units mode. If you try to use the materials library in another units mode, it will use the numerical values of the properties without converting them, and give you wrong answers. For example, the density of concrete is about 2300 kg/m3. If you start COMSOL in FPS (Foot Pound Second) mode, it will use 2300 as the density of concrete in lb/ft3, which is much too high.

  • Very important fact hidden away in the documentation: "The eigenvalue algorithm does not work reliably when the parameter in the Search for eigenvalues around edit field is equal to an eigenvalue. [If your problem has a zero eigenvalue] you must change the value of this parameter."
